Output c626be6a39984bd64e34c21386f1f3d84bd74919528c8aca3c732556136e4f8a:15

value
1110425882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57599beb480b6dd5158776dc7b2db82c2c2e22c3 OP_EQUAL
address
MFs2NGP4d9qpqChb74p2QgCnYzXzfAm3G8
transaction
c626be6a39984bd64e34c21386f1f3d84bd74919528c8aca3c732556136e4f8a
spent
true